around here, the cars that last the longest are the cars that rust the slowest... hondas are definitely not them! That said, there are cars that rust faster than hondas (nowadays anyway)... hondas do seem to run a long time with minimal effort from the owner. But they usually rust or get totalled by the teenage driver behind the wheel before the engine or tranny goes out...
Brands like Saab and Volvo and Audi (of the newer generation anyway) take a long time to rust. That's why they appeal more than other cars to me.
I wonder if the survey was only for new car buyers? I can see Volvo doing well there... but judging from folks here, there a lot of Saab buyers who buy used, and then keep them >>7 years...
